Granted, we are not as exotic as Bora Bora or the Maldives but St. Croix (pronounced Kroy) has one of the longest continuous fringing reefs in the Caribbean. Topside St. Croix’s history and topography make it as diverse as it is underwater. St. Croix is surrounded by secluded beaches and tropical fauna so you’ll have many choices of excursions to fill your time when you’re not diving on St. Croix’s famous dive sites. Underwater, St. Croix has over 50 dive sites scattered around the island, you’ll have a choice between wall dives (with shallow reef tops), colorful northshore reef dives, shallow sloping reefs out west and wreck dives (both deep and shallow wrecks). Oh, and one of the BEST pier dives in the Caribbean. Sealife is abundant on St. Croix with more than 500 species of fish, 40 types of coral, and hundreds of invertebrates that inhabit our waters.

You get in a harness that connects to a sloping overhead metal wire strung out between tall, vertical objects (e.g.: towers, trees, etc...) and you 'zip' across from the higher to the lower. A popular excursion at cruise ship ports, and can be found as an attraction at some other land sites. Here's an upstate New York page with a photo showing a couple of zip liners.



Another poster mentioned 'all inclusive,' and that's right. What 'all' means varies. To a non-drinker like me, it means at least the meals, and often some snacks, are covered in the package price. Sometimes A.I. packages include some alcoholic beverages, and sometimes they don't. If that's something you want, be mindful the selection could be quite limited.
